Hi, I have a problem with include function in EG, I have a polish e-mail there, but instead of polish characters I just see �
If I don't use the include function and I have the e-mail directly in the sas program - is ok, when I do it global is not.
My code:
filename genericq ('.' '/abc/cde/) encoding="utf-8";
%include genericq('generic.sas');
How can i fix it?
The encoding option on the filename statement assigns the encoding to use when writing to a file.
Try using the encoding option on your %include which is meant to be used when reading a file in that has a different encoding.
